What is there to do in Anchorage near my hotel with views?
Anchorage has enough sights and experiences to keep you on the hop for weeks (or months!), starting with Anchorage Museum. Alaska Zoo, Alaska Native Heritage Center and H2Oasis Indoor Waterpark are other well-known attractions. If you're lingering longer, Alaska Aviation Heritage Museum and Point Woronzof Park are great additions to your itinerary.
